Howard Edward Glover (born February 14, 1935) is a Canadian retired professional ice hockey right winger.
His brother, Fred Glover, was also a player and coach in the National Hockey League.
Glover played for the following teams during his career: Toronto Marlboros, Barrie Flyers, Cleveland Barons, Toledo-Marion Mercurys, Winnipeg Warriors, Chicago Blackhawks, Calgary Stampeders, Buffalo Bisons, Detroit Red Wings, Pittsburgh Hornets, New York Rangers and Montreal Canadiens.
